Luke Kuechly Inducted into Pro Football Hall of Fame
Linebacker Luke Kuechly, who spent his entire eight‑year NFL career with the Carolina Panthers, was enshrined in the Pro Football Hall of Fame on Saturday in Canton, Ohio. At 28, Kuechly retired early because of concussions, yet he earned Defensive Rookie of the Year, Defensive Player of the Year, five All‑Pro selections and helped lead the Panthers to Super Bowl 50.
Former high‑school coach Steve Specht recalled Kuechly’s obsessive film study routine, noting how the future Hall of Famer would watch, pause, and replay game tape repeatedly to dissect opponents. Former Panthers defensive coordinator Sean McDermott praised Kuechly as possibly the best linebacker ever, while former teammates and coaches shared stories of his impact on and off the field during a week of tribute shows leading up to the ceremony.
